                   RECOGNIZING SPACE COAST CITY FEST

                                 ______
                                 

                            HON. BILL POSEY

                               of florida

                    in the house of representatives

                        Thursday, March 12, 2020

  Mr. POSEY. Madam Speaker, on March 28th and 29th, 2020, Brevard 
County families along with 100 business owners and 190 local church 
organizations will gather together to celebrate Space Coast City Fest. 
This uplifting event will take place at Space Coast Daily Park in 
Melbourne, FL, concluding a year and a half long outreach effort to 
unite the Christian Community.
  Space Coast City Fest was created as a region-wide campaign to serve 
churches in the community and promote faith-based works. Over a period 
of 18 months, CityFest and CityServe have worked to raise the level of 
involvement of Brevard County churches in serving community needs. The 
focus of their initiatives include building long term partnerships with 
public and non-profit groups to help

[[Page E308]]

serve our schools, meet the needs of children within the foster care 
system, raise awareness & seek solutions for the Opioid crisis, tackle 
homelessness, feed the hungry, and revitalize troubled and sometimes 
forgotten neighborhoods.
  In addition, special events were held to promote unity among church 
leaders and spread a message of Christian hope. The ReNew gathering 
drew more than 2,000 people for a night of worship & teaching, a 
conference for pastors and ministry leaders was attended by several 
hundred church leaders, an educational forum on community issues, and 
various training sessions were offered to church members. In the ten 
days leading up to the final festival event, a Christian message was 
shared in several smaller settings including a surf camp with Cliff and 
Damian Hobgood, two presentations in area prisons, a luncheon and a 
dinner for women, and a business and civic leaders' luncheon.
  The final event is a family-oriented festival at the Space Coast 
Daily Park next to Viera High School on March 28th and 29th. The 
festival will host a children's area and an action sports program that 
includes professional BMX, Free-Style Motocross, and skateboard 
demonstrations. The event will wrap up with a mainstage program of 
contemporary Christian music bands from around the county, and will 
also include a message of hope from international evangelist Andrew 
Palau. Other featured performers include Adam Agee, Mandisa, Newsboys 
United, Blanca, Illusionist Jon Michael Hinton, Danny Gokey, and 
Lecrae. Thousands are expected to attend.
  I would like to recognize the hard work of the local organizing 
committee chaired by Christopher Burton and Dr. Mike Ronsisvalle in 
partnership with the Luis Palau Association. Their efforts over the 
last 18 months of mobilizing events have greatly impacted our community 
and have brought us all together in a very special way. It's notable 
that the $800,000 cost of the Space Coast City Fest Celebration was 
contributed by local churches, individuals, and businesses so that it 
could be free to the public.
  I ask my colleagues in the U.S. House of Representatives to please 
join me in recognizing Space Coast City Fest.
